(TibetanReview.net, Jun29’26) – Two US Senators have on Jun 25 asked China to rescind its law meant to assimilate the ethnic minority populations in the country ahead of its coming into force on Jul 1. Titled as Law for Promoting Ethnic Unity and Progress, the legislation threatens the distinct identities, religious freedoms, and fundamental rights of Tibetans, Uyghurs, and other ethnic minorities, Republican Senator Lindsey O Graham and Democratic Senator Sheldon Whitehouse have said in a letter to the Chinese Ambassador to the US, Xie Feng.
